Ashworthius sidemi (Nematoda, Trichostrongylidae) in wild ruminants in Białowieza Forest.

A.W. Demiaszkiewicz、J. Lachowicz、B. Osińska2009-01-01PubMed

Between 2003-2007, abomasa of 91 European bison (Bison bonasus), 4 red deer (Cervus elaphus) and 2 roe deer (Capreolus capreolus) shot in the Białowieza Primeval Forest (Poland) were examined for worms presence. All the animals examined were infected with nematodes A. sidemi with an exception of one bison, that was sh…

Local condensation around oxygen vacancies in t-LaNbO4 from first principles calculations

Akihide Kuwabara、Reidar Haugsrud、Svein Stølen 等 4 位作者2009-01-01Physical Chemistry Chemical Physics

First principles calculations reveal that formation of a fully ionized oxide vacancy leads to local condensation of coordination polyhedra forming Nb3O11(7-) in t-LaNbO4.
